Aux Air Valve on 22re
I have an air valve on my 1985 22re. I have experience some confusion on whether it is supposed to pass air at all when hot or not. What I have read says it is supposed to pass a little air all the time. I was able to shut off the leak with a new o-ring but I removed it also. Any input on this valve would be interesting. Thanks
The air valve's only function is to raise idle when cold.

Yeah, it may pass a little air when hot, but is should only allow enough air to increase the idle by 50 RPM's (according to the FSM)
As long as you get a fast idle with a cold engine, and the idle lowers as the engine warms up, it's working fine. The only problem I have is the orifice in the throttle body that leads to the air valve clogs up after many miles. Easy fix though.
